A long-time source for local and independent hip-hop information just launched a new podcast.
Hosted by local hip hop aficionado, Cheats, the founder of the Cheats Movement Blog, the show is set to come out every other week and seeks to become “the premier independent hip hop podcast.”
The show features other local hip hop bloggers and friends of Cheats—Hip Hop Henry, the cofounder of The Listening Party, Jahn Parker, music blogger for Earmilk, Roger Tyler, hip hop guy for RVA Magazine, and Forest Lodge, another contributor to the Cheats Movement—all hanging out, discussing “the current state of hip-hop,” premiering new hip hop records, and interviewing big-name local artists.
In the first episode, the crew discuss Nickelus F’s newest release “Triflin,’”and get an in-studio visit from Richmond natives Joey Gallo, Fly Anakin, and Koncept Jack$on.
The podcast is part of the larger blog project’s goal “to highlight the best of humanity through art, culture, and community.”
